WebMain treatments for MG Acetylcholinesterase inhibitors are a type of fast-acting drug that improves nerve signals to the muscles. Pyridostigmine (Mestinon®) is the medicine most often prescribed. 1,2 Steroids (corticosteroids) are a type of hormone used to control MG symptoms quickly.

Web21 jul. 2024 · Unlike in autoimmune myasthenia gravis, there is no role for immunotherapy in congenital myasthenic syndromes. If available, a genetic diagnosis should drive the choice for a first-line treatment agent between cholinergic agents, β-adrenergic agents, and open-channel blockers. WebNYU Langone doctors may prescribe medication to improve muscle contraction and muscle strength for people with myasthenia gravis. A type of medication called a cholinesterase inhibitor can do that by preventing the breakdown of acetylcholine, an important chemical in the communication between nerves and muscles.
